Atlanta CorpsVets All-Age Drum and Bugle Corps is proud to announce its scholarship offerings for 2010. Out of remembrance of friends lost and in appreciation for our community, CorpsVets offers several scholarships each year to help performers offset the cost of tuition for various marching and scholastic undertakings.
Jason Lowe Memorial Scholarship - Atlanta CorpsVetsThe Jason Lowe Scholarship honors the memory of Jason Lowe, a young CV member and drum corps enthusiast who passed from cancer in the summer of 2001. Jason’s brave spirit and enthusiasm for this activity touched many. To honor Jason’s memory, a scholarship of $250 to offset the expense of member tuition is offered to marching members of any corps. |

Brooklyn United has now entered its 5th year of reuniting old & new friends from the tri-state area. The corps is Directed by Tom Breen and assisted by Dee Burbulak & Russell O'Mara.
The instructors for the corps since it's start are Wes Myers on percussion & Rich Red Wardlow on Brass. We have many advisors on board, Tommy Martin, John Screech Arietano to name a few & Bucky Swan who played a big part in getting this corps back on the map.
We continue with this project with rehearsals in Brooklyn, NY @ OLPH St Gerard's Hall located at 5902 6th Ave Brooklyn, NY 11220 & we also host rehearsal at our NJ location at the Madison Elks, 192 Main st Madison, NJ 07940. SoCal Dream Drum and Bugle Corps are pleased to announce an endorsement agreement with Dream Cymbals & Gongs ("Dream"). Under the terms of the agreement, Dream will be the exclusive supplier of the Cymbals & Gongs for the corps. The new line of equipment will make its debut for the 2010 season.
“We are thrilled with our new relationship with Dream; it was a match made in heaven and appreciates the support the company has afforded us in outfitting our percussion section,” says Corp Director Michael Nash, “The new equipment is a Dream to behold." |

After severe weather caused the cancellation of our first January rehearsal, the CorpsVets were finally able to have our first rehearsal of 2010. The horn line met at East Coweta Middle School and was presented with music for five minutes of this season's show, 360. We spent a productive day working music. The evening session was capped off with a "light" workout by visual instructor Chris Freeman.
Then it was time for making CorpsVets history as the members were able to take advantage of housing at the rehearsal facility. Sunday dawned gray and cloudy with more than a few moans and thoughts of a quick demise for Chris as payment for Saturday's workout. But after a warm shower and some breakfast it was back to work. The members were treated with visual rehearsal in the morning and in the afternoon more music with Alan Armstrong and Freddy Martin. The brass rehearsal worked fundamentals and the ballad which has goose bumps written all over it. As rehearsal ended, the threatening weather appeared; it is not a CorpsVets rehearsal unless you have to load the truck in the rain!
